The tip for beating the heat by ramping up the air conditioning is, in the bigger picture, incredibly misguided, and criticism of it is sharply on-topic. Donuel is right to say that we are failing to address the big issue, and there is absolutely no doubt that the resort to air conditioning, which consumes vast amounts of western nations' electricity generation, is one of the major contributors to that failure. It isn't even ironic that cooling your house or office makes the earth's atmosphere hotter. It's become bloody obvious, and your comfort is a dire threat to someone else, maybe someone a conveniently long way away, out of sight. Actually, thousands of air conditioners belching out hot air in a city makes that city considerably hotter, so it can even be bad on a local level.

An air-conditioned hospital ward can be vital and life-saving. That would be appropriate use of the technology. Routine use in homes and office blocks as soon as the temperature goes up is not appropriate. We occasionally stay at a hotel in London in which the rooms each have aircon - and non-opening windows. Insane.
